Introduction of the VQ35 Engine
Established as component of Nissan's VQ engine family members, the VQ35 engine is a 3.5-liter V6 powerplant that has actually amassed a credibility for its balance of efficiency and performance. Introduced in the very early 2000s, this engine has been used in various Nissan and Infiniti versions, including the Murano, Altima, and 350Z. Its layout incorporates a light weight aluminum alloy block and DOHC (Twin Overhead Camshaft) arrangement, which contribute to its portable and lightweight nature.
The VQ35 engine includes a 60-degree V-angle and utilizes variable shutoff timing modern technology, boosting both power shipment and fuel performance. With an optimal result normally around 280 horse power and 270 lb-ft of torque, it provides appropriate efficiency for a mid-sized SUV. The engine is additionally understood for its smooth operation and reasonably low sound levels, making it appropriate for family-oriented cars like the Murano.

Usual Concerns
While the VQ35 engine is celebrated for its total Reliability, it is not without its share of usual concerns that owners might experience. One frequent problem entails the engine's oil intake. Numerous VQ35 proprietors report excessive oil burning, which can lead to low oil degrees and possible engine damages otherwise attended to without delay.
One more problem relates to the timing chain. vq35. The VQ35 is equipped with a timing chain rather than a belt, which normally calls for less upkeep, some proprietors have experienced chain stretch and associated rattling sounds, especially in older versions. This can bring about severe engine damages otherwise diagnosed early
Additionally, the engine might endure from coolant leaks, especially at the consumption manifold. Such leakages can result in overheating and subsequent engine failure if not taken care of.
Lastly, the mass air flow sensing unit (MAF) can fail, causing efficiency issues such as rough idling and a decrease in fuel effectiveness. vq35.
